sphinxjp.themecore 0.1.3

A sphinx theme plugin support extension. #sphinxjp
sphinxjp.themecore is a Sphinx theme plugin extension.

Setup

Make environment with easy_install:

easy_install sphinxjp.themecore

Make your plugins

themes

If you want to integrate new theme, write sphinx_themes entry_points in your setup.py:

entry_points = """
 [sphinx_themes]
 path = sphinxjp.themes.s6:get_path
"""


and write get_path function that return path of Sphinx themes. Sphinx themes directory include one or more theme directories.

directives

If you want to integrate new directive, write sphinx_directives entry_points in your setup.py:

entry_points = """
 [sphinx_directives]
 setup = sphinxjp.themes.s6:setup_directives
"""


and write setup_directives function that receive app argument and return None. setup_directives is same as sphinx extension's setup function. See Sphinx extension document for more information.

Main features:

  • provide theme template collection by using setuptools plugin mechanism.

last updated on:
July 10th, 2011, 12:28 GMT
price:
FREE!
homepage:
bitbucket.org
license type:
MIT/X Consortium License 
developed by:
Takayuki SHIMIZUKAWA
category:
ROOT \ Documentation
sphinxjp.themecore
Download Button

In a hurry? Add it to your Download Basket!

user rating

UNRATED
0.0/5
 

0/5

Rate it!
What's New in This Release:
  • fix fatal bug on version 0.1.2. sorry.
read full changelog

Add your review!

SUBMIT